Output 88dcdcbf33c69626f1f2b8ddb291183df023e27185fdc35da02153c83200535e:2

value
3128540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f6cefed31768fbcac6427c1d794ef7636636df OP_EQUAL
address
3LvVVPVarpaqswHFCinHbzBKx94k9LKqjo
transaction
88dcdcbf33c69626f1f2b8ddb291183df023e27185fdc35da02153c83200535e
spent
true